Background <p>The effects and safety of acute-phase rehabilitation in older patients with immunoglobulin A (IgA) nephropathy undergoing steroid therapy remain unclear. In particular, evidence on the impact of steroid therapy on physical function is limited. This case study aimed to examine the effects of acute-phase rehabilitation on physical function over time in an older patient with IgA nephropathy.</p> Case presentation <p>The patient was an 89-year-old woman diagnosed with IgA nephropathy following renal biopsy. Prednisolone (30&#xa0;mg) was initiated on day 21 of hospitalization. Moderate-intensity exercise therapy (40&#xa0;min, five times per week) was started, and included resistance training, balance training, aerobic training, and activities of daily living training. Grip strength increased from 14.8 to 17.7&#xa0;kg by day 22 but decreased to 15.4&#xa0;kg by day 49. The Short Physical Performance Battery score improved from 9 to 10 points by day 22 but dropped to 8 points thereafter, with a marked decline in chair stand performance. Gait speed and tandem standing remained stable. The 6-min walk distance improved steadily from 310 to 390&#xa0;m. Renal function remained stable, with estimated glomerular filtration rate changing from 40.9 to 35.6&#xa0;mL/min/1.73 m<sup>2</sup> and urine protein/creatinine ratio improving from 6.5 to 1.6&#xa0;g/gCr.</p> Conclusions <p>Moderate-intensity exercise therapy may be safely applied in older patients with acute IgA nephropathy undergoing steroid therapy and may help maintain exercise tolerance. However, early decline in lower limb function suggests the importance of comprehensive support from the early phase.</p>
